一、什么是虚拟币SE? 虚拟币SE(简称SE币)是一种基于区块链技术的数字资产,它的诞生与发展与全球金融科技的快...
在近年来飞速发展的数字货币市场中,合约的概念逐渐成为人们关注的焦点。特别是智能合约,它使得各种交易和协议可以在无需信任第三方的情况下自动执行。为了理解虚拟币中的合约,首先需要知道什么是合约,以及它在虚拟币生态系统中扮演的角色。
合约通常指的是一种法律协议,可以是口头的也可以是书面的。然而,在虚拟币的世界中,合约更常指的是一种编程协议,尤其是智能合约。这种合约存在于区块链之上,可以在提前设定的条件满足时自动执行。这种特性使得合约在数字货币的交易中拥有非凡的潜力,能够降低交易成本,同时提高效率和透明度。
智能合约基于区块链技术,其核心功能是自动化、透明和安全。智能合约的核心组件是代码,它定义了合约的条款和条件。当每个条件得到满足时,合约就会自动执行。由于这些合约被存储在区块链上,所有的参与者都可以验证合约的执行,从而减少了欺诈的可能性。
比如,假设某公司与客户签订了一个智能合约,约定在客户付款后48小时内交付服务。当客户将付款提交到指定的区块链地址后,合约内置的代码会检测到这个事件,并自动指示执行交付。这一过程无需中介介入,大大提高了交易的速度和安全性。
智能合约有许多独特的优势,使其在虚拟币中的应用越来越普遍:
智能合约在多个行业中找到了其应用的场景。以下列举了一些比较典型的例子:
1. 金融行业:使用智能合约可以自动执行贷款、支付和保险等金融协议,不再依赖中介。
2. 供应链管理:智能合约可以跟踪产品的流转,确保产品在供应链中的每个环节都是透明可追溯的。
3. 房地产交易:通过智能合约,可以简化房产交易过程,确保交易的处置效率,不需要繁琐的纸质合同和法律程序。
4. 投票系统:利用智能合约的透明性和安全性,可以建立相对公正的电子投票系统。
创建一个智能合约通常需要少量的编程知识。首先,你需要了解使用智能合约的区块链平台,常见的平台包括以太坊、EOS等。其次,学习相关的编程语言,例如以太坊建议使用Solidity语言。
这里是创建智能合约的一般步骤:
智能合约的法律效力问题仍在不断讨论中。目前,大部分法律体系并未明确承认智能合约的法律地位。然而,随着越来越多的企业和机构采用智能合约,法律界也开始对此持开放态度。
在某些情况下,智能合约可以通过特定的法律框架获得法律效力,比如通过建立必要的证据链。此外,智能合约本身的可追溯性和透明性为法律诉讼提供了强有力的支持,相关推动正在进行中。
尽管智能合约有很多优点,但它们并非没有风险。以下是一些常见的风险:
智能合约的成本主要体现在开发、测试和部署阶段。相对于传统合约,尽管前期费用较高,但由于智能合约能够自动化执行,长期来看可以节省大量的交易时间和人力成本。因此,在高频交易或者大规模交易的情况下,智能合约的经济效益更为明显。
在许多数字资产交易平台中,智能合约被用来实现资产的交易和管理。例如,许多NFT(非同质化代币)项目利用智能合约创建、管理和交易数字艺术作品和游戏资产。通过智能合约,数字资产的购买、赎回、转让等操作能够在无需中介的情况下自动完成,从而实现高效流转。
为了评估智能合约的安全性,你需要关注以下几个方面:
总之,智能合约在虚拟币中的地位日益重要,其自动化执行的特性为交易带来了前所未有的变革。在理解智能合约的基础上,用户可以在这个新兴领域进行深入的探索和应用,掌握未来的机会。